3. auThOrized use

Incorrect use of the solenoid valve Type 0293 can
be dangerous to people, nearby equipment and the
environment.
• The device is designed for dosing, blocking, filling and

aerating media.

• The device is classified in accordance with DIN EN 161

Group 2, Class A for gas.

• Use according to the permitted data, operating conditions

and conditions of use specified in the contract documents

and operating instructions. These are described in the

chapter entitled

“Technical Data”.

• The device may be used only in conjunction with third-

party devices and components recommended and

authorised by Bürkert.

• Correct transportation, correct storage and installation

and careful use and maintenance are essential for reliable

and problem-free operation.

• Use the device only as intended.

3.1. predictable misuse

• Do not physically stress the device (e.g. by placing objects

on it, using it as a screwing aid, standing on it or using it
as a lever arm).

• Do not make any external modifications to the device

housings. Do not paint the housing parts or screws.

4. basic safeTy

insTrucTiOns

These safety instructions do not make allowance for any:
• Contingencies and events which may arise during the instal-

lation, operation and maintenance of the devices.

• Local safety regulations – the operator is responsible for

observing these regulations, also with reference to the
installation personnel.

Danger!

Danger – high pressure!
• Before loosening the lines and valves, turn off the pres-

sure and vent the lines.

Risk of electric shock!
• Before reaching into the device, switch off the power

supply and secure to prevent reactivation!

• Observe applicable accident prevention and safety

regulations for electrical equipment!

Risk of burns/Risk of fire if used continuously through
hot device surface!
• Keep the device away from highly flammable substances

and media and do not touch with bare hands.

Caution!

Risk of injury due to malfunction of valves with alter-
nating current (AC).
Sticking core causes coil to overheat, resulting in a
malfunction.
• Monitor process to ensure function is in perfect working

order!

General hazardous situations.
To prevent injury, ensure that:
• The system cannot be activated unintentionally.
• Installation and repair work may be carried out by autho-

rized technicians only and with the appropriate tools.

• After an interruption in the power supply or pneumatic

supply, ensure that the process is restarted in a defined

or controlled manner.

• The device may be operated only when in perfect condi-

tion and in consideration of the operating instructions.

• The general rules of technology apply to application plan-

ning and operation of the device.
